article thumbnail

Why Agents Should Share Their CMA With The Appraiser

Birmingham Appraisal

From an appraiser’s perspective, I know that we work with agents to make sure the appraisal is done in a timely manner with the most accurate information possible. While agents and appraisers cannot discuss value we can talk about the property and why they may have priced it at what they did.

article thumbnail

Commercial Appraisal: Understanding the Basics

AmeriMac

Commercial Real Estate Appraisal is a crucial process that helps determine the value of commercial properties. It plays a significant role in several aspects, from buying and selling to lending purposes. Becoming a commercial appraiser requires appropriate education, training, experience, and certification.

article thumbnail

Choosing the Right Appraiser: A Guide for Agents, Attorneys, Accountants, and Homeowners

Birmingham Appraisal

Certification and Licensing Appraisal standards and regulations are vital to maintaining the integrity of the profession. It’s imperative to choose an appraiser who is certified and licensed in the state they appraise in. A licensed appraiser demonstrates commitment and accountability to their clients and the industry.
